    The Huntington Free Library is a privately endowed library near Westchester Square in the New York City borough of the Bronx, which is open to the public. It has a non-circulating book collection. The Reading Room has mostly early-20th century items. It includes a special collection of books and photographs on local Bronx history.

    Cedarmere is located behind a high stone wall on a 7-acre (2.8 ha) parcel along Bryant Ave., Roslyn Harbor, with two small ponds and a landscape designed by Frederick Law Olmsted. Its main house is a three-bay, 2 + 1 ⁄ 2-story main block with two wings: a two-story multi-bay structure to the east and a smaller, single-story section to the north.
